My Buying Guides on 19 X 33 Drop In Kitchen Sink

When I decided to upgrade my kitchen, choosing the right 19 x 33 drop-in kitchen sink was a key step. If you’re in the same boat, here’s everything I learned from my experience to help you pick the perfect sink for your space.

Understanding the Size: Why 19 x 33 Inches?

The 19 x 33 dimension refers to the width and length of the sink. I found this size to be a great balance—large enough to handle big pots and pans but still fitting comfortably in most standard kitchen countertops. Before buying, I measured my countertop cutout to ensure the sink would fit perfectly without any modifications.

Material Matters: What Sink Material Should You Choose?

I explored several materials for drop-in sinks:

  • Stainless Steel: Durable, easy to clean, and resistant to stains and heat. It’s what I ultimately chose because it matched my kitchen’s modern look and was budget-friendly.
  • Porcelain or Ceramic: Offers a classic look and is easy to maintain but can chip or crack.
  • Composite Granite: Very durable and scratch-resistant but tends to be heavier and more expensive.

Choosing the right material depends on your style preference, durability needs, and budget.

Installation Type: Why Drop-In Works for Me

Drop-in sinks sit on top of the countertop with the edges visible. I picked this style because it’s easier to install than undermount sinks and works well with my existing countertop. If you’re a DIY enthusiast, this type makes installation more straightforward.

Depth and Bowl Configuration

Although 19 x 33 refers to the footprint, the depth and number of bowls are equally important. I chose a single deep bowl to accommodate large cookware and make washing easier. If you prefer multitasking, some 19 x 33 sinks come with double bowls or accessories like cutting boards and drying racks.

Drain Placement and Accessories

Drain location affects plumbing and usability. I opted for a sink with the drain centered to maximize space underneath. Also, look for models that include strainers or come with optional accessories for added convenience.

Maintenance and Cleaning Tips

From my experience, stainless steel sinks require regular cleaning with mild soap and a soft cloth to maintain their shine. Avoid abrasive cleaners that can scratch the surface. For porcelain sinks, wiping spills quickly helps prevent stains.

Budget Considerations

Prices for 19 x 33 drop-in sinks vary widely based on material and brand. I set a budget early on and found good quality stainless steel sinks at a reasonable price. Remember to factor in installation costs if you’re not doing it yourself.
